

We have partnered with Chestnut Homes, who is offering the prize for the most creative garden project carried out in the county during lockdown.
But with the deadline for entries to its summer gardening competition now just two weeks away, the Lincolnshire housebuilder is encouraging those who haven’t already done so to send in a photo of their eye-catching horticultural endeavour before it’s too late.

Steve Bark, Landscape Gardener at Chestnut Homes, said: “We have already received many entries from across the county displaying a wide variety of imaginative projects.
“From incorporating natural wildlife into the garden, to sprucing up their outdoor area with a variety of flowers, and finding a way of recycling old belongings to give them new and practical uses, the sheer range of entries has been extremely impressive.
“While the size of some of the projects has caught our eye, bigger does not necessarily mean better in this competition.
“Ultimately, we are looking for the venture which demonstrates the most creativity and imagination.
